Lorena López

Senior consultant specialising in project management related to tourism, environment and human development. She holds a Master’s Degree in Project Management from the Business Engineering School LA SALLE, Ramón Llull University (Barcelona), as well as a Degree in Contemporary History from the University of Santiago de Compostela and a Diploma in Tourism from the University Carlos III of Madrid. Participant in the International Programme of Specialisation in Tourism and International Cooperation for Development organised by the World Tourism Organisation (UNWTO).

She has more than 15 years of multidisciplinary experience in different areas related to the strategic planning of tourism, the enhancement of historical and natural heritage, sustainable tourism development in protected areas, as well as strengthening work with local communities for the empowerment of productive processes linked to tourism.  She has worked on projects funded by different multilateral organisations such as the World Bank, Inter-American Development Bank, Australian Aid, UNDP and Europe Aid. She has participated in the development and management of projects in Ghana, Spain, Dominican Republic, Brazil, Paraguay, Chile, Uruguay, Nepal, Maldives and Georgia.
